Byron Allen strikes deal to buy controlling stake in BuzzFeed and become CEO
Data: Financial Modeling Prep; Chart: Christine Wang/Axios Byron Allen, a media entrepreneur known for aggressively trying to roll up various media assets, on Monday announced a deal to buy a majority stake in BuzzFeed. Why it matters: The deal gives the 20-year-old digital publisher a much-needed lifeline. Without a buyer, the company likely would've been forced to file for bankruptcy.
